how do i cook a 6 kg turkey?
If the weight of a turkey is 6 kg, it has to be cooked accurately to ensure its tenderness and optimal flavor. Begin by preheating the oven to 180 degrees Celsius (350 degrees Fahrenheit). Clean the turkey thoroughly, removing any giblets or excess fat. Season the turkey with salt, pepper, and your preferred herbs and spices. Place the turkey breast-side up on a roasting rack in a baking pan. Cook the turkey for 20 minutes per kilogram, or until the internal temperature reaches 74 degrees Celsius (165 degrees Fahrenheit). To achieve a golden brown skin, brush the turkey with melted butter or olive oil every 30 minutes during the cooking process. To check if the turkey is cooked thoroughly, insert a meat thermometer into the thickest part of the thigh, ensuring it doesn’t touch the bone. Let the turkey rest for at least 15 minutes before carving and serving, allowing the juices to redistribute and keep the meat succulent.

do you cook a turkey covered or uncovered?
Should you cook a turkey covered or uncovered? It depends on what you want your turkey to look like. If you want a golden brown, crispy skin, then you should cook it uncovered. However, if you want a moist turkey, then you should cook it covered. You can also cook the turkey covered for the majority of the cooking time, and then uncover it for the last 30 minutes to get a crispy skin. No matter which method you choose, make sure to baste the turkey regularly with butter or oil to keep it moist.
what temperature do i cook an unstuffed turkey?
The ideal temperature for cooking an unstuffed turkey is 325°F. To ensure that the turkey is cooked safely and evenly, it is important to use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the turkey. The turkey is cooked when the internal temperature reaches 165°F in the thickest part of the breast and 175°F in the thigh. If you are cooking a stuffed turkey, the internal temperature should reach 165°F in the stuffing. It is important to allow the turkey to rest for at least 15 minutes before carving to allow the juices to redistribute throughout the turkey. This will result in a more tender and flavorful turkey.

how long do you cook a turkey at 325?
According to the USDA, cook the turkey breast side up at 325°F for 13 minutes per pound for an unstuffed turkey, or 15 minutes per pound for a stuffed turkey. Ensure the internal temperature reaches 165°F in the thickest part of the thigh. Cover the bird loosely with foil to prevent over-browning. A turkey’s size usually ranges between 10 to 30 pounds, which means cooking times can vary significantly. To ensure accurate cooking time, consult a reliable cooking guide or recipe based on the exact weight of your turkey. Remember to factor in additional time for the resting period, typically 20 to 30 minutes, before carving and serving the delicious turkey.
